This room is considered a junior suite. As a result, we got to skip most of the line and walk right on board.
Our junior suite was surprisingly spacious and thoughtfully designed.
The large TV did welcome us, however, in Spanish. Um, but it was an easy fix using the remote.
One of the best parts about this junior suite is the balcony. Now, this balcony is bigger than a typical balcony room because it is a junior suite.
